  • Patent number: 8478299
    Abstract: Various embodiments are described for obtaining coarse location for a mobile device. In one embodiment, a mobile device may comprise one or more interfaces for detecting location reference nodes in view of the mobile device and a client module to send a location query to a location database. The location query may comprise node data identifying the reference nodes in view of the mobile device. The location database may be configured to respond to the location query with positioning information for providing an estimated position of the mobile device. The positioning information may be based on correlated position data and node data received from one or more client devices having Global Positioning System (GPS) position determination capability and configured to report position data and node data for location reference nodes in view. Other embodiments are described and claimed.

  • Patent number: 8321556
    Abstract: A method of storing collected data on a wireless device. User interaction with a wireless device and/or the performance of the wireless device is monitored and data related thereto collected. The collected data may be structured into a tagged hierarchical structure comprising a plurality of events that are separate and independent from one another. Each event may describe a specific application with a plurality of attributes. The tagged hierarchical structure formed as a tree structure is translated into a syntax generic language. The result may be formed into a compact format using a zipped format and/or a binary-equivalent format and then stored and transmitted to a central location (e.g., a server) for statistical analysis processing. The server transforms the received data into expanded format and forms a hierarchical tree structure for each event and its attributes. The result is processed for producing a statistical analysis of the collected data.
